About This Role
As a Project Manager, you'll own the end-to-end delivery of solar and storage projects, from handoff to closeout, ensuring they meet scope, budget, and schedule targets. Your work directly contributes to reducing carbon emissions and expanding renewable energy access across the US.
💡 A Day in the Life
Start your day reviewing project schedules and updating risk registers, then join a call with the EPC to discuss progress and change orders. Afternoon is spent coordinating with utilities on interconnection timelines, reviewing financial forecasts in Sage Intacct, and preparing compliance documents for an upcoming audit.

🎯 Who Pivot Energy Is Looking For
- Has 3+ years of project management experience specifically in renewable energy (solar/storage) or infrastructure construction, not just general PM.
- Proven track record of managing contracts, budgets, and CPM schedules using tools like Procore, Sage Intacct, or Power BI.
- Comfortable coordinating diverse stakeholders (EPCs, utilities, AHJs) and managing change events with financial discipline.
- Holds a Bachelor's in Engineering, Construction Management, or Business, or can demonstrate equivalent hands-on experience in solar project execution.
📝 Tips for Applying to Pivot Energy
Highlight specific solar/storage project examples with metrics (MW, budget, timeline) in your resume and cover letter.
Mention your proficiency in Procore, Sage Intacct, or Power BI; if you lack direct experience, note transferable skills with similar systems.
Tailor your application to show understanding of Pivot Energy's focus on community solar and decarbonization impact.
Emphasize experience with contract administration and change order management, as these are core to the role.
Include a brief note on your ability to work remotely across time zones, as the role is remote (US).
